F&M Bank to Open Amherst Branch in Winchester on June 12

 

Timberville, VA (June 9, 2023)— On Monday, June 12, F&M Bank will continue its growth in Winchester with a new full-service branch located west of Old Town at 1738 Amherst Street. This will be F&M Bank’s 14th branch in Virginia and its second in the Winchester market.

F&M Bank identified Winchester as a strategic growth opportunity due to its thriving local economy, prospering businesses, robust non-profit network, and a community that’s committed to preserving its history while at the same time looking to the future.

“We’re celebrating our 115th year of operations by expanding our presence in Winchester, Virginia. We’re committed to continuing to invest in the community of Winchester and are excited for how this venture will help us better serve families and businesses around the city,” said Mike Wilkerson, Chief Executive Officer, and Winchester native. “The ‘Top of Virginia’ is thriving, and our sweet spots of agriculture, non-profit, and business banking reflect the needs of our community. F&M is committed to organic growth and market expansion in a world of bank consolidation and branch closures. When we expand our ability to serve our customers, everybody wins.”

In January 2021, F&M Bank opened a commercial banking and loan production office in the Winchester market with an experienced banking team with a 20-year history of working together. This northern Shenandoah Valley market has accrued over $36 million in deposits and $21 million in loans. Mr. Wilkerson led the team, which still consists of John Sargent, SVP of Northern Valley Market Executive, Jonathan Reimer, SVP of Commercial Relationship Manager, Gail Pryde and Ronda Gross, Business Relationship Specialists, and Bill Steele, VP, Senior Credit Analyst. Since the company’s expansion into Winchester, the team has added Lauren Fravel, Banking Center Specialist, David Sweeney, Senior Mortgage Advisor, and Jason Dorsey, Credit Analyst.

Today, with the announcement of its second Winchester location opening, this team is excited to leverage its 150 years of combined banking experience to deliver customized loan, deposit, and cash management solutions to business and personal customers.

Eduardo Santiago was named Branch Manager for the Amherst St Winchester location. Eduardo brings nearly a decade of experience to the team and is eager to welcome new customers.

The branch is located at 1738 Amherst Street, at the corner of Amherst Street and Linden Drive. The hours are 8:30 am to 5:00 pm, with extensive digital offerings available online and on the F&M Bank mobile app.

About F&M Bank

F&M Bank Corp. (OTCQX: FMBM) proudly remains the only publicly traded organization based in Rockingham County, VA, and since 1908, has served the Shenandoah Valley through its banking subsidiary F&M Bank, with full-service branches and a wide variety of financial services, including home loans through F&M Mortgage, and real estate settlement services and title insurance through VSTitle. Both individuals and businesses find the organization’s local decision-making and up-to-date technology provide the kind of responsive, knowledgeable, and reliable service that only a progressive community bank can. F&M Bank has grown to $1 billion in assets with over 175 full and part-time employees.
